Water resources of the Penobscot River basin, Maine . s. It must be kept in mind that the run-off during Apriland May usually includes the greater part of the precipitation storedin the form of snow, beginning about the middle of November. The record shows a considerably higher discharge for the Piscata-quis than for the other tributaries, partly because the gaging stationis much nearer the source of the river than are the gaging stations onthe other tributaries. The precipitation on the upper part of thePiscataquis basin is undoubtedly considerably greater than themean precipitation on the whole basin, and the unit discharge atFoxcroft is correspondingly greater than at the mouth of the Piscata-quis. The records for the Foxcroft gaging station are probablynot as reliable as those for the other tributaries, on account of thevariable use of water at the mills above Foxcroft, and the estimatesof flow during the winter months at Foxcroft are probably subjectto considerable error.
